Regulators

The pressure-building regulator may be adjusted without removal from the system. The following pro-

cedure describes the process:

1

Fill the container with liquid product.

2

Open the pressure-building valve and allow the container pressure to stabilize for about an hour.

Note the pressure.

3

Loosen the lock nut on the adjusting screw on the top of the regulator. Raise the set point by turn-

ing the adjusting screw clockwise; lower the set point by turning the screw counterclockwise. When

decreasing the setting, the pressure building valve must be closed and the container vented to a lower

pressure. Repeat step two and observe the change.
